FAQs for San Francisco Mint Gold Coins
What is the San Francisco Mint?
Congress established the San Francisco Mint in 1852 in response to the California gold rush and the need of miners to have their new-found gold made into coins. The “S” Mint mark was used on San Francisco coins until 1975, although production in San Francisco was suspended between 1955 and 1965.
Does San Francisco have a silver dollar coin?
San Francisco Old Mint Silver. In 2006, the United States Mint released a silver dollar commemorative coin which commemorates the 100th anniversary of the survival of the old San Francisco mint in the 1906 San Francisco earthquake. The mint also played a part in the city's recovery after the earthquake.
What happened to the San Francisco gold coins?
Gold coins were being produced in San Francisco in larger quantities than any of the US Mints. In addition, the San Francisco Mint struck coins for an array of Latin America and Pacific Rim countries. For 32 years, coin production continued uninterrupted. This all changed on April 18, 1906.
When did the San Francisco mint start making circulating coins?
The San Francisco Mint made circulating coins with the “S” mint mark from 1854 to 1955. After that, they produced “S” circulating coins from: In 1968, proof coin production moved from the Philadelphia Mint to San Francisco and proof coins gained the “S” mint mark.
